One of the oldest branches of engineering is the construction of boats. It is concerned with the construct the hulls of boats and sailboats, masts, spars and rigging. Wooden boat making is more popular for amateur boat builders due to the reason that wood is cheap, floating, widely available and can easily be constructed.

For starters, the ideal is to learn the parts of a boat, such as the bow, bulkhead, Chinese, deck, gunwale, keel keelson, rudder, sheer, rod, tape, Stern and stern. You can look up the definition of each part of the boat upon to decide whether you want to build one.
The wood is generally not resist abrasions and fresh water or aquatic organisms will be allowed to penetrate the wood that will be a cause of deterioration. Generally, Oak and cedar are selected to make wooden boat (in the construction of ship hulls), due to its characteristic resistance to rot. Woods, as okoume, mahogany and iroko are also being used to build the hull, however, if you want to build a boat using these new kinds of wood, you need extra attention to make sure that the wood is actually certified by the FSC. Typically, the wood is covered with an epoxy polymer coating instance.Structural (SP) method or the more ancient method is being used West epoxy coverage.
Typically, the teak being used to build the deck while Keruing, azobis, merbau are used for the beams. You will need to glue, screws and / or nails to attach the wood components.
Some types of wood construction that normally apply includes amateurs, caravel, which involves attaching wooden planks to a frame to form a smooth bark; lapstrake is a technique in which wood planks are fitted together with a slight overlap that is beveled to a business setting; strip planking method is mostly preferred by amateurs in wooden boat making , because it is faster, avoids hard work and temporary gig modeling of the boards are not required.
